Output 74f03e77a460bfba9f867e45b4c5f9a0f4e236b6bf3ac1234abb637c6be5f9a7:0

value
21203
script pubkey
OP_0 OP_PUSHBYTES_20 56bab037c754cabb8254cc6ad8cf4629bd02a1ba
address
bc1q26atqd782n9thqj5e34d3n6x9x7s9gd6qmgqa3
transaction
74f03e77a460bfba9f867e45b4c5f9a0f4e236b6bf3ac1234abb637c6be5f9a7
confirmations
134433
spent
true